Trident reports 23% drop in Q4 PAT to Rs 102 crore
▼ Bearish +0.33%
Trident's net profit dropped significantly by 23% year-on-year due to a 12.4% decline in revenue from core divisions like towels and bedsheets. This weak performance highlights persistent top-line pressure in export markets, which will likely weigh down the stock in the near term. Consequently, positional and swing traders may see bearish momentum over a multi-day to multi-week timeframe until demand recovery is visible.

Trident Q4 Results: Revenue slips 12% YoY, net profit comes in at ₹102 crore
▼ Bearish +2.7%
The company's sharp top-line contraction of over 12% and a significant 23.6% bottom-line drop to ₹102 crore signal ongoing demand or pricing headwinds in its core home textiles segment. Although the operational margins showed structural resilience sequentially, the year-on-year deceleration is highly likely to lead to an immediate 3-5% negative price adjustment over a multi-day swing timeframe as the market recalibrates forward earnings growth projections.
Textile exports to get a boost with the India-New Zealand FTA
▲ Bullish +0.73%
As a major exporter of home textiles and yarn, Trident stands to benefit from the immediate removal of 5-10% duties in New Zealand, enhancing its pricing edge over global competitors. This creates a positive mid-term swing catalyst as export volumes are projected to rise. The company's focus on cotton-based products aligns perfectly with New Zealand's import profile.
